The Role of Timing in Shaping Your Umrah Budget

The timing of your Umrah journey plays a crucial role in determining the overall cost of your trip. Just like with any international travel, the price of an Umrah ticket can fluctuate significantly depending on the season, the number of pilgrims traveling at the same time, and the availability of services. Understanding these dynamics can help travelers budget more effectively and avoid last-minute financial surprises.

Umrah is typically considered a non-haram (not obligatory) pilgrimage, which means that it can be undertaken at any time of the year. However, the busiest periods for Umrah are during the Islamic months of Ramadan and the days of Eid al-Fitr and Eid al-Adha. During these times, the number of pilgrims increases dramatically, leading to higher demand for services such as transportation, accommodation, and guided tours. As a result, ticket prices tend to rise during these peak periods. Travelers who plan their Umrah during off-peak months, such as late spring or early autumn, may find that they can secure more affordable packages and enjoy a more relaxed experience.

Moreover, the availability of flights and travel services can also impact the cost of an Umrah ticket. During peak seasons, airfares and service fees often increase due to high demand, which can add to the overall budget. On the other hand, booking your ticket several months in advance can help you secure better rates and avoid last-minute price hikes. Some travel providers also offer early-bird discounts or special promotions for bookings made well in advance, which can be a great way to save money while ensuring a smooth and stress-free journey.

By carefully considering the timing of your Umrah pilgrimage, you can make more strategic decisions that align with both your spiritual goals and your financial planning. Whether you choose to travel during a busy season or an off-peak period, being aware of how timing affects pricing can help you navigate the Umrah ticket market with greater confidence and control over your expenses.

Understanding the Hidden Fees Behind the Ticket

While the base price of an Umrah ticket may seem clear-cut, many travelers are often surprised by the additional costs that can significantly impact their overall budget. These hidden fees, which may not be immediately apparent, can include service charges, booking fees, and other charges that are sometimes buried in the fine print of the package details. Understanding these costs is essential for making an informed decision and avoiding unexpected financial surprises.

One of the most common hidden fees is the service charge, which is typically a percentage of the total ticket price. This fee is often added to cover the costs of the travel provider’s services, such as customer support, administrative tasks, and the management of bookings. While these charges are standard in many industries, they can add up, especially when combined with other fees. It is important to review the breakdown of fees provided by the travel provider to understand exactly what you are being charged for.

Another potential hidden cost is the booking fee, which is sometimes applied when you make a reservation through an online platform or a third-party service. These fees can vary depending on the provider and may be added as a one-time charge or as a percentage of the total ticket price. Some travel agencies may also charge additional fees for expedited processing or for making changes to your booking. It is crucial to read the terms and conditions carefully to ensure that you are aware of all potential charges before making a commitment.

Additionally, some providers may include optional services or extras in their packages, such as travel insurance, guided tours, or special accommodations. While these services can enhance your Umrah experience, they are often not included in the base price and may come at an extra cost. It is important to clarify what is included in your package and what is optional to avoid any misunderstandings or unexpected expenses.

By being aware of these hidden fees and understanding how they contribute to the overall cost of an Umrah ticket, travelers can make more informed choices and ensure that their pilgrimage is both spiritually fulfilling and financially sound.

Planning for the Unexpected: Budgeting for Additional Expenses

While the ticket price for an Umrah journey is a significant part of the overall cost, it is essential to consider the additional expenses that may arise during the pilgrimage. These unforeseen costs can include transportation to and from the airport, accommodation, meals, and personal expenses. Planning for these additional costs in advance can help travelers avoid financial stress and ensure a smoother, more enjoyable experience.

Transportation is often one of the first expenses to consider. While some travel packages may include airport transfers, it is important to confirm the details with the provider to avoid any last-minute surprises. If you are booking your own transportation, it is advisable to research the most cost-effective options, such as using public transportation or shared taxi services, which can help reduce the overall expenses. Additionally, having a contingency fund for unexpected travel delays or changes in flight schedules can be beneficial in ensuring that your Umrah journey remains on track.

Accommodation is another important consideration, especially if your travel package does not include hotel stays. The cost of lodging can vary depending on the location, season, and type of accommodation. It is advisable to book your accommodation in advance and compare different options to find the best value. Some travelers may also find it beneficial to stay in shared accommodations or budget-friendly hotels to reduce costs while still enjoying a comfortable and convenient stay.

Meals and personal expenses should also be factored into your budget. While some packages may include meals, it is important to be aware of any additional costs that may arise, such as dining out or purchasing personal items. Having a flexible budget that allows for some unexpected expenses can help ensure that you are not caught off guard by additional costs during your pilgrimage.

By planning for these additional expenses in advance and allocating a portion of your budget for unforeseen costs, travelers can ensure that their Umrah journey is not only spiritually fulfilling but also financially manageable. This proactive approach can help alleviate stress and allow for a more enjoyable and stress-free pilgrimage experience.
